Maintenance Engineer Responsibilities
- Reduce equipment breakdown duration and frequency by carrying out fault finding and planned preventative maintenance on automated production line equipment.
- Perform mechanical fault finding on conveyors, monorail systems, and pneumatic equipment, primarily replacing components like-for-like.
- Conduct electrical fault finding using a multimeter and reading electrical schematics.
- Responsible for site preventative maintenance and responding to ad hoc repair requests during shifts.
The Candidate
- Completion of an electrical/mechanical maintenance or engineering apprenticeship or qualification.
- Experience in electrical and mechanical fault finding.
